Why skin peels and heels crack — and what this has in common with vitamins and fats

Dry skin, peeling and cracked heels are common complaints. There are many causes: dry air, water, improper care, age. But nutrition plays an important role: the fat-soluble vitamins A and E and Omega-3 fatty acids participate in building the skin barrier and retaining moisture.

The skin is the largest organ, and its condition largely reflects what we eat. If the skin is dry even with good care, it is worth paying attention to a deficiency of these nutrients. Let's look at the role of each.

Key idea: vitamins A and E and Omega-3 are the "builders" of the skin barrier. Their deficiency can manifest as dryness, peeling and cracks. But dry skin does not always mean deficiency — a comprehensive approach matters.

🦶 Why skin becomes dry

The skin protects itself from moisture loss with a lipid barrier — a layer of fats between the cells of the stratum corneum. When this barrier is weakened, moisture evaporates, the skin becomes dry, peels, and cracks appear in stressed areas (heels).

Factors: dry air, hot water, aggressive detergents, age, as well as a lack of fats and fat-soluble vitamins in the diet.
Important: if dryness and cracks do not go away, do not ignore them — sometimes this is a sign of diseases (thyroid, diabetes) or deficiencies. Consult a doctor.

🥕 Vitamin A: cell renewal

Vitamin A (retinol and its precursors) is critical for the skin: it participates in cell renewal, healing and maintaining the barrier. Its deficiency can cause dry skin, peeling and "chicken skin" (follicular hyperkeratosis).

Mechanism: vitamin A regulates skin cell division and maturation. With deficiency, the skin renews more slowly and becomes dry and rough.
Caution: vitamin A is fat-soluble and accumulates. Its excess (especially retinol) is toxic. Get it from food and carotenoids, and supplements — as prescribed by a doctor.

🌻 Vitamin E: antioxidant and barrier

Vitamin E is a fat-soluble antioxidant. It protects membrane and skin lipids from oxidation, supporting the barrier and hydration. Vitamin E is often added to creams, but its dietary level matters too.

Mechanism: vitamin E "quenches" free radicals that damage skin lipids. This helps preserve barrier functions and prevent dryness.
Nuance: vitamin E works better with vitamin C. Sources — nuts, seeds, vegetable oils.

🐟 Omega-3: the lipid layer

Omega-3 fatty acids (especially EPA and DHA) participate in building cell membranes and the skin barrier. Their sufficiency helps the skin retain moisture and reduce inflammation. Omega-3 deficiency can contribute to dry skin.

Mechanism: Omega-3 integrate into cell membranes, making them more "fluid" and moisture-retaining. This improves the skin barrier.
Sources: fatty fish (salmon, mackerel, sardines), flaxseed, chia, walnuts.

🔍 Other causes of dryness and cracks

Vitamin deficiency is not the only cause. Possible factors:

CauseComment
Dry air/waterHeating, hard water, hot shower
CareAggressive products, lack of moisturizing
AgeWith age the skin barrier weakens
DiseasesThyroid, diabetes, eczema, psoriasis
DeficienciesA, E, Omega-3, zinc, essential fats
When to see a doctor: cracked heels can become infected. With deep, painful or non-healing cracks, as well as severe dryness — see a dermatologist.

🥗 Food sources and norms

What to add to your diet for the skin:

NutrientSourcesNorm/day
Vitamin A (retinol)Liver, eggs, dairy~900 mcg (men), ~700 mcg (women)
Beta-carotene (provitamin A)Carrots, pumpkin, sweet potatoPart of the A need
Vitamin EAlmonds, sunflower seeds, oils~15 mg
Omega-3 (EPA+DHA)Salmon, mackerel, sardines~250–500 mg/day
How to eat: fat-soluble vitamins absorb with fats. Pair carrots with oil, and vegetables with nuts or fish.

💡 Practical recommendations

A comprehensive approach to dry skin:

1

Moisturize the skin

Creams with ceramides and humectants, especially after a shower.

2

Gentle heel care

Pumice, moisturizing products with urea, but without aggression.

3

Omega-3 and fats

Fatty fish twice a week or quality Omega-3 supplements.

4

Vitamins A and E from food

Vegetables, nuts, oils, organ meats — without supplement megadoses.

5

Water and protection

Drink enough water, protect the skin from wind and dry air.

Bottom line: dry skin and cracked heels can reflect a deficiency of vitamins A, E and Omega-3. Nutrition, care and adequate fats help. But with persistent problems — consult a dermatologist.
